Q 1.. If Bachittar Natak is the autobiography of Guru Gobind Singh Ji, then why there is no mention of Vaisakhi 1699 (Amirt Sanskar), battle of Chamkaur Sahib, and martyrdom of the younger Sahibzades?

A 1. This is an amusing question.

Bachittar Natak is a voluminous work and includes Apni Katha, the autobiography of Guru Gobind Singh ji. This is the fifth composition in Sri Dasam Granth Sahib.

Sri Dasam Granth Sahib has fifteen compositions. The first is Jaapu Sahib and the last is Zafarnamah. Except for the Zafarnamah, the letter written to Aurangzeb, the rest of the compositions were completed by 1696 A.D. (bikrami 1753).

It was a brilliant idea to record the date, time, place and year of the completion of this work. This is evident from the closing lines of Chritropakhyan, the fourteenth composition. It says:

“On the banks of river Satluj the granth was completed on Sunday, Bhadro Sudi Eighth 1753 bikrami (1696 A.D). This closes the dialogue between the King and his ministers and with this the four hundred and four episodes come to a good end”.

ਸੰਬਤ ਸਤ੍ਰਹ ਸਹਸ ਭਣਿੱਜੈ॥ ਅਰਧ ਸਹਸ ਫੁਨਿ ਤੀਨਿ ਕਹਿੱਜੈ॥
ਭਾਦ੍ਰਵ ਸੁਦੀ ਅਸ਼ਟਮੀ ਰਵਿ ਵਾਰਾ॥ ਤੀਰ ਸਤੁੱਦ੍ਰਵ ਗ੍ਰੰਥ ਸੁਧਾਰਾ॥405॥
ਇਤਿ ਸ੍ਰੀ ਚਰਿਤ੍ਰ ਪਖਯਾਨੇ ਤ੍ਰਿਯਾ ਚਰਿਤ੍ਰੇ ਮੰਤ੍ਰੀ ਭੂਪ ਸੰਬਾਦੇ
ਚਾਰ ਸੌ ਚਾਰ ਚਰਿਤ੍ਰ ਸਮਾਪਤਮ ਸਤੁ ਸੁਭਮ ਸਤੁ॥404॥7555॥ਅਫਜੂੰ॥

Autobiography, unlike biography is obviously written during the lifetime of the author and has the incidents mentioned up to that period of time.

Now the Order of the Khalsa was initiated on Vaisakhi, 1699 A.D. b. (1756) and Sri Dasam Granth completed in 1699 A.D. (1753 b)

Battle of Chamkaur Sahib was fought on 7 Poh, Samvat 1761 (1704 A.D.) and younger Sahibzadas of Guru Gobind Singh ji attained martyrdom during this period.

It is thus obvious that the autobiography penned by Guru Gobind Singh ji, years ahead could not include the events and incidents that took place later on.


Q 2. Is Triya Chritra part of Dasam Granth?

A 2. There is no composition by the name of Triya Chritra in Sri Dasam Granth. There is however a composition called Chritropakhyan (chritra+pakhyan). Chritra means the character or characteristics. Pakhyan means the story which has already been told. Chritra never means wiles, tricks or trickster. It is chritra and not challitar (wiles) as some have tried to present it mischievously.

Even Guru Arjan Dev ji in Rag Sarang praises the Lord for His characteristics.

Chritropakhyan is an independent book which forms part of all the hand-written volumes of Sri Dasam Granth. There is no volume of Dasam Granth where this book is not included.

Text from Chritropakhyan is included among the five banees of Amrit initiation and also forms part of the nitnem. Without this banee neither amrit can be prepared nor nitnem be completed. Thus questions regarding this banee should be raised responsibly and cautiously.

The theme and the plot of the stories of Chritropakhyan, as is clear from the word pakhyan, were already there but those stories were re-written, re-cast or re-shaped.

Chritropakhyan is also gender neutral and does not pertain to any particular gender. Though predominantly it relates to women, it also has stories of men, saints, preachers, pandits, maulvis, kings, courts and courtiers,

The literary canvas of Chritropakhyan is amazingly wide.


Q. 3 Is Dasam Granth also a Granth like Guru Granth Sahib?

A. 3 No. Sri Dasam Granth is not one granth like Sri Guru Granth Sahib. It is a kuliyat, or collected works. Sri Dasam Granth is collection of different books in one volume.

Sri Guru Granth Sahib is one granth comprising banee of different Gurus, Bhakhats, Bhatts etc. The banee of Sri Guru Granth Sahib is on one theme and subject. It is a spiritual fountain. Primarily it is for the uplifting of the soul and helps it unite with the Ultimate One.

Sri Dasam Granth Sahib on the other hand is a collection of different books, on different subjects but coming from one pen. The theme of the volumes included in Sri Dasam Granth Sahib has a very vast range. Absolute spirituality is found in Jaapu Sahib, Akaal Ustat etc. Shastar Nam Mala, Gyan Parbodh, Chritropakhyan etc form the literary compositions. Then there are Puranic epics like Ramavtar, Krishnaavtar, Chandi di vaar, Chaubees Avtar etc. The entire compositions are in conformity and aims of Guru Granth Sahib.

Q 8. Is it true that since the time of the writing of Dasam Granth, there has been a controversy about its authorship?
A 8. No it is not true.
There had never been any controversy regarding the authorship of Sri Dasam Granth till the beginning of the last century. The first known case of casting aspersions on the authorship of some of the banees was in the form of Babu Teja Singh Bhasaur. He however didn’t only cast aspersions on the banee of Sri Guru Gobind Singh Ji, but also on the Bhagat banee and the Bhatt banee present in Sri Guru Granth Sahib. For this he was excommunicated from the Sikh panth.
If, at all, there had been any issue before that, it was limited to whether Sri Dasam Granth be kept in one volume or split into different volumes. The simple reason for this was that Sri Dasam Granth Sahib is not one book. It is a collected works containing books on different subjects bound in one volume.
Bhai Kahn Singh Nabha, an encyclopedic authority on Sikh religion gives a detailed account about Sri Dasam Granth Sahib in Gurmat Martand, Vol. 2. Page 568. published by SGPC. The account is as follows:
In the year Samvat 1778 (1721 A.D.) i.e. thirteen years after Guru Gobind Singh ji's demise Mata Sundri ji appointed Bhai Mani Singh ji as Granthi of Darbar Sahib, Sri Amritsar. Bhai Mani Singh ji discharged his duty very efficiently and during his tenure compiled different books including volumes of Sri Guru Granth Sahib and a volume containing writings of Guru Gobind Singh ji. He took a lot pain to collect writing from poets and devout Sikhs and prepared A Granth of the Tenth Master, known as Dasvin Patshahi ka Granth.
Bhai Mani Singh ji attained martyrdom in Samvat 1795 (1738 A.D.) i.e. thirty years after the Guru Gobind Singh ji left this world. Thereafter the Sikhs chose to send the volume of Dasam Granth to Damdama Sahib for perusal which was the seat of learning at that time and was known as Guru ki Kanshi.
Volume of this Dasam Granth was discussed in detail in the Khalsa Divan. There three views emerged. First: the entire volume be kept as such and be not split into different parts. Second: we should have one Granth only which has been conferred guru ship by Guru Gobind Singh ji himself and this Granth be split into different books so that the learned, scholars, Gianis and students are able to study it according to their competency. Third: many said that it should be split into two parts, one containing sri mukhvak banee which enunciates the principles of the of Khalsa and the second volume should contain the history etc. Fourth: many said that the volume prepared by Bhai Mani Singh ji should remain intact but certain deficiencies be removed, like searching missing portions etc .Fifth: many were of the view that the rest of the Granth be kept as such but the Chritras and eleven Hikayats, which could not be recited in the open divan and is more difficult for ladies, should be kept in another volume. Many more suggestions came but the gathering could not reach to any conclusion. Then Bhai Mehtab Singh Mirankotia came to the venue and said “I am going to punish Massa Ranghar for desecration of Sri Harimandir Sahib. If I come back alive after killing Massa Ranghar then this Granth should be preserved as such, and if I attain martyrdom then this should be split into different books”. Bhai Mahtab Singh returned safe after accomplishing the feat and the ' beer' of Dasam Granth remained intact.
From this brief account given by Bhai Kahn Singh it is very clear that there was no dispute at all about the authorship of Sri Dasam Granth. After the conclusion Bhai Kahn Singh names the 'Granth' as 'beer' a word normally not used for any ordinary book or volume.
